I just got back from an extremely quick trip out to the Hagati Valley where I spent a day visiting Hagati Secondary (where I taught during Peace Corps) and the library.

The library seems to be continuing fairly well. They had just received three more boxes of books and magazines like National Geographic the day before I arrived. It seems like there are usually around 15 visits a day, though sometimes double that on Sundays.

Mr. Mbunda, the headmaster at Hagati, greets you and thanks you a lot for the donated money. Some of the funds are being used help pay the school and examination fees of three students who are orphans (one technically still has a father, but he is crazy) and have difficult economic conditions. The money also was used to set up electricity in one room which is going to be used as a computer lab / photocopy room. And the remainder of the money will be used on shelves and tables for the library (which will be in the same room as the computer lab).
